cbse full mark is 500 ?? plz tell me its urgent for me to know..

GyanaPrakashRout 4th Aug, 2021

Dear Aspirant,

In CBSE Total is of 600 marks but one is additional . Only the marks from the top 500 marks is counted. Total marks of each subject is divide between Theory and Practical or Project or Assessment.

I have passed bsc in physics, its been 4 years I passed class 12. Will I be able to qualify neet in 1 year of time?

ADITYA KUMAR Student Expert 4th Aug, 2021

Hi

It doesn't matter even if you have completed your bsc physics you are still eligible for neet provided you must have passed 12th board examination with physics, chemistry ,biology/biotechnology and English and must have got at least  50  % in aggregate of PCB  i.e Physics, Chemistry and Biology /biotechnology
